Join a team where your passions come first. Whether you are a Pediatric specialist or have a unique caseload interest you're itching to pursue, Ability Action Australia wants to support your vision. We offer the ultimate community-based flexibility for clinicians at all stages of their career. Why You'll Love It Here: Ultimate Flexibility: Design your own schedule with full-time or part-time options. You have control of your own calendar. Competitive Rewards: Industry-leading salary, salary packaging, comprehensive clinical toolkits, laptop + phone is provided, km reimbursement for billable travel, achievable bonus incentives opportunities, options to purchase additional leave......+ more! Grow Your Way: Access a generous PD allowance and a clear career pathway through AAA and MedHealth. A multitude of in-house clinical programs on offer across all disciplines, implemented via our large training & development teams. Balance: A true hybrid model-work from home, the clinic, via telehealth & out in the community. Unrivaled Support: Benefit from structured, consistent clinical supervision and mentoring from some of the best Speech Pathologists in the country. Your Role: Deliver evidence-based, life-changing therapy in homes, schools, via telehealth and the community. You will manage a caseload you actually enjoy, using clinical observations and assessments to help NDIS participants get more out of life.
